Enjoying food is a subjective experience, and people have different preferences and dietary restrictions. However, there are many delicious and nutritious foods that are generally enjoyed by a wide range of people. Here are some foods that you might consider enjoying:

  1. Fruits: Fresh fruits like apples, bananas, berries, oranges, and mangoes are not only tasty but also packed with vitamins, minerals, and fiber.
  2. Vegetables: A colorful variety of vegetables such as spinach, broccoli, carrots, bell peppers, and tomatoes offer a wide range of flavors and nutrients.
  3. Whole Grains: Foods like brown rice, quinoa, oats, and whole wheat pasta provide complex carbohydrates, fiber, and essential nutrients.
  4. Lean Proteins: Options like chicken breast, turkey, fish, tofu, and legumes (beans, lentils, chickpeas) are great sources of protein.
  5. Nuts and Seeds: Almonds, walnuts, chia seeds, and flaxseeds are nutrient-dense and make for tasty snacks or additions to meals.
  6. Dairy or Dairy Alternatives: Greek yogurt, low-fat milk, and dairy-free alternatives like almond milk or coconut yogurt can be part of a balanced diet.
  7. Healthy Fats: Avocado, olive oil, and fatty fish like salmon provide healthy fats that are beneficial for heart health.
  8. Herbs and Spices: Enhance the flavor of your meals with herbs like basil, cilantro, and thyme, as well as spices such as cinnamon, turmeric, and paprika.
  9. Dark Chocolate: In moderation, dark chocolate with a high cocoa content can satisfy your sweet tooth while providing antioxidants.
  10. Water: Staying hydrated with water is essential for overall health and can help you enjoy your meals more.

Remember that balance and moderation are key to a healthy diet. It's important to enjoy a wide variety of foods to ensure you get a broad spectrum of nutrients.
